Southeast Gulf of Mexico .SYNOPSIS...High pressure over the area will continue to produce a gentle to moderate anticyclonic flow through the period. Fresh northeast to east winds will pulse offshore the N and W coasts of the Yucatan peninsula each night through Wed night, with the exception of fresh to strong winds on Sat night. .TONIGHT...N to NE winds 5 kt. Within 200 nm east of the coast of Florida .SYNOPSIS...Low pressure of 1015 mb centered just off the Georgia coast will continue to weaken while slowly moving inland late today or tonight. High pressure of 1030 mb located NE of Bermuda extends a ridge across the forecast region. The pressure gradient between these two systems is resulting in an area of fresh to strong southerly winds from 20N to 27N between 68W and 74W. These winds will diminish on Sat, then a moderate to fresh anticyclonic flow will prevail through at least Mon as a high pressure center settles over the NE corner of the forecast area. .TONIGHT...SE winds 5 to 10 kt S of 27N, and SE to S 15 to 20 kt N of 27N.
